Eureka Man Arrested for Attempted Homicide

This is a press release from the Eureka Police Department. The information has not been proven in a court of law and any individuals described should be presumed innocent until proven guilty:

Grant, Michael Grant, MichaelOn June 16, 2017 at about 9:32 a.m., the Eureka Police Department received reports of two shots fired in the area of Wabash Avenue and B Street. The suspect was seen leaving in a black Dodge Charger. Officers responded and located two shell casings in the street on the 20 block of Wabash Avenue.
During the course of the investigation the intended victim of the shooting was identified. The victim was able to identify the shooter as 34 year old Eureka resident, Michael Grant. Based on supporting evidence, investigators developed probable cause that Grant attempted to kill the victim.
On June 21, 2017 at about 9:23 p.m., Michael Grant was arrested within a block of where the shooting took place. He was in possession of a loaded handgun. Grant was booked into the Humboldt County Correctional Facility on a warrant and fresh charges for felon in possession of a firearm.
On June 23, 2017 at 4:00 p.m., investigators booked Grant with attempted murder and domestic violence. Anyone with further information regarding this incident is asked to call Senior Detective Harpham at (707) 441-4305.
